Buenos Aires Book Fair -The Buenos Aires Book Fair and ALA invite up to 25 ALA members to attend the Buenos Aires Book Fair. Each April, more than one million readers from all over Latin America visit the premises and take part of the thousand-plus literary events we organize. The Buenos Aires Book Fair Free Pass Program provides 1. Free registration to the Fair, 2. 4 night hotel stay (six nights, if you share with a colleague who is also part of the program), 3. Book fair bag, 4. Invitation to Welcome reception, 5. Invitation to Official opening ceremony.

Rovelstad Scholarship for International Librarianship - Through the generosity of Mathilde and Howard Rovelstad, the Council on Library and Information Resources (CLIR) is pleased to announce a scholarship for a student of library and information science to attend the World Library and Information Congress of the International Federation of Library Associations and Institutions ( IFLA).
